About the Role

The University of Pennsylvania's Institute of Contemporary Art (ICA) is seeking freelance seasonal staff for the role of Visitor Services Attendant & Gallery Ambassador. This role serves as the first point of contact for visitors, shapes the public's experience, and leads tours for diverse audiences. The position requires an informed engagement, thoughtful facilitation, and a confident front-of-house presence.

Responsibilities

  • Provide a high level of service in greeting, orienting, and assisting ICA visitors
  • Lead guided tours and support interpretive engagement with exhibitions for diverse audiences
  • Answer questions and engage guests in informed, welcoming conversations about ICA and its programs
  • Process book and merchandise purchases
  • Complete book inventory and restock materials as needed
  • Maintain cleanliness, organization, and readiness of public spaces and the bookshop
  • Provide information and assistance related to ICA’s accessibility amenities
  • Assist guests during emergency egress, medical situations, or other unusual circumstances, following established protocols
  • Handle challenging interactions with professionalism, discretion, and sound judgment
  • Actively participate in required trainings and continuously expand knowledge of ICA’s exhibitions, policies, and visitor services practices
  • Support additional visitor services and front-of-house needs as assigned

Requirements

  • High school diploma or equivalent education and experience required
  • 1-2 years of relevant experience in customer or guest services, hospitality, event management, education, or protection services
  • Demonstrated interest in public engagement, education, and working with diverse audiences
  • Strong interpersonal and communication skills with an outgoing, professional demeanor
  • Ability to manage conflict and de-escalate challenging situations effectively
  • Capacity to remain calm and attentive during high-volume, high-stress, or unexpected situations
  • Strong organizational skills and attention to detail
  • Interest in art, museum education, or visitor experience; art background a plus
